Book Overview

"The Fairy Ring," compiled by Kate Douglas Smith Wiggin and Nora Archibald Smith, is a captivating collection of fairy tales and short stories designed to enchant young readers. This anthology brings together timeless tales filled with magical creatures, brave heroes, and enchanting adventures. Illustrated by E. MacKinstry, the stories transport children to fantastical realms where anything is possible.

From classic fairy tales to lesser-known gems, this collection offers a diverse range of narratives that spark imagination and foster a love for reading. Perfect for bedtime stories or classroom reading, "The Fairy Ring" is a treasure trove of literary delight that will captivate children's hearts and minds.
